Let us actively explore why they matter so much. What Are Medical Absorbent Pads?
You might initially mistake them for simple paper sheets. However, true medical absorbent pads offer much more advanced technology. They feature a sophisticated, multi-layered design for maximum protection. First, a soft, non-woven top layer directly touches the skin. This specific layer ensures maximum comfort and actively prevents annoying irritation.
Underneath, you will find a highly advanced absorbent core. Manufacturers typically use Super Absorbent Polymer (SAP) for this vital section. Consequently, this core quickly absorbs liquid and transforms it into gel. Furthermore, a waterproof PE backsheet acts as the final barrier. This sturdy bottom layer completely stops any liquid from leaking through.
Therefore, these pads provide reliable, leak-proof security for everyday use. You can confidently place them on beds, chairs, or wheelchairs. Specifically, they lock moisture away from the body instantly and safely.
Why Medical Absorbent Pads Are Essential for Home Care
Using hospital-grade underpads elevates your daily caregiving routine significantly. They offer far more benefits than simple mattress protection. Specifically, let us examine their top four advantages for daily home use.
1. Superior Infection Control
Managing bodily fluids safely requires strict hygiene protocols. Consequently, untreated moisture quickly breeds dangerous bacteria and painful infections. Disposable medical absorbent pads effectively isolate these harmful fluids. They create a vital, sterile barrier between the patient and the bedding.
Furthermore, you can simply discard the used pad immediately. This straightforward action drastically reduces the risk of dangerous cross-contamination.
2. Excellent Wound Care Management
Proper wound care management demands a completely clean workspace. During routine dressing changes, medical solutions often spill unexpectedly. Moreover, healing wounds frequently release natural fluids or blood. Therefore, placing a pad under the patient catches every single spill safely.
The highly absorbent core traps these fluids instantly and securely. As a result, the bed remains perfectly dry and hygienic. You no longer need to worry about ruining expensive bedsheets. Ultimately, this clean environment helps sensitive wounds heal much faster.
3. Reliable Incontinence Protection
Seniors dealing with incontinence often feel deeply embarrassed. Frequent daily leaks completely destroy their dignity and personal confidence. Thankfully, premium incontinence bed pads provide a highly discreet, reliable solution. They instantly lock away urine and neutralize foul odors continuously.
Thus, bedridden patients stay comfortable and dry throughout the entire night. Furthermore, they protect fragile skin from painful rashes and irritation. You actively protect both their physical health and emotional well-being simultaneously.
4. Reducing the Caregiver’s Burden
We deeply understand that caregiving exhausts you both physically and mentally. Constant laundry easily consumes your precious time and energy. However, disposable medical absorbent pads eliminate this heavy daily burden entirely. You simply remove the soiled pad and replace it quickly.

Finding the perfect product requires some careful, practical consideration. You absolutely cannot simply grab the cheapest option available online. Instead, you must carefully evaluate your loved one's specific daily needs. Here are three crucial factors to consider when buying:
- Absorbency Levels: Different situations require entirely different fluid capacities. Light leaks only need standard, everyday protection. Conversely, overnight use strictly demands heavy-duty, maximum absorbency cores.
- Size and Coverage: A pad that is too small offers zero protection. Therefore, carefully measure the bed, wheelchair, or furniture first. You must confidently ensure the pad covers the target area completely.
- Material Quality: Cheap plastic often causes terrible sweating and painful skin tears. Thus, you must actively seek out soft, breathable, cloth-like top layers. Premium materials consistently keep the skin safe from dangerous bedsores.
